Aaron Yoder, a world record holder in backwards running, shares his journey from traditional running to backwards running due to a knee injury. He highlights the benefits of backwards running, such as reduced knee impact, and discusses his coaching methods and the global community of backwards runners. Yoder emphasizes the unique perspective and personal satisfaction gained from competing against oneself.
